Product Details
Garden Circus canvas print by Jane Arlyn Crabtree. Bring your artwork to life with the texture and depth of a stretched canvas print. Your image gets printed onto one of our premium canvases and then stretched on a wooden frame of 1.5" x 1.5" stretcher bars (gallery wrap) or 5/8" x 5/8" stretcher bars (museum wrap). Your canvas print will be delivered to you "ready to hang" with pre-attached hanging wire, mounting hooks, and nails.

Artist's Description
Garden Circus is from an original fluid acrylic abstract painting. The colors remind me of a colorful circus. Bright Oranges, striking yellows, and popping purples. The foliage is made up of a variety of shades of green with an occasional pop of blue. Pansies, Poppies, Snapdragons, Sunflowers, Mums and Hydrangeas are just a few of the flowers that influence my artwork.
About Jane Arlyn Crabtree

Artist JANE ARLYN CRABTREE Pure talent is the only way to describe Jane Crabtree's craft. Growing up in a small South Carolina town Jane always saw the world differently than those around her. She started creating not long after she mastered walking. When it became time to go to college Jane chose to study art. She mastered many mediums but acrylic paints were always her favorite, the medium she creates with today. After college Jane took a risk leaving her 9 to 5 business job and started her own business designing needlework patterns. It was a decision that changed her life forever.
